Transaction 27538095a6e6a84b078a862df33e56580b6ec17ee97f3752ffe586a6bd40214d
1 Input
1 Outputs
- 27538095a6e6a84b078a862df33e56580b6ec17ee97f3752ffe586a6bd40214d:0
value 19370868
address 1LpX5fS5pk7CRwHzcTWt3Bdn5NPEjhxM5Y